Locafy Reports Fiscal Fourth Quarter and Full Year 2025 Results
Globenewswire· 2025-11-12 21:10
Core Insights - Locafy Limited reported financial results for the fiscal fourth quarter and full year ended June 30, 2025, focusing on its transition to a partner-based sales model and the launch of its Localizer product in the U.S. market [1][10][12]. Financial Performance - Total operating revenue decreased by 31.2% to A$829,000 from A$1.2 million in the comparable year-ago period, primarily due to a 99.3% decline in service-related revenues [12][11]. - Subscription revenues increased by 9.7% to A$801,000 from A$731,000 in the comparable year-ago period, with expectations for strong growth following the launch of Localizer [12][11]. - The net loss for the year was A$4.3 million, or A$2.63 per diluted share, compared to a net loss of A$1.9 million, or A$1.49 per diluted share, in the prior year [18][24]. Strategic Initiatives - The company transitioned to a partner-centric go-to-market model, allowing Locafy to maintain direct billing relationships with end customers, which enhances cash-flow predictability and aligns sales incentives with performance [5][12]. - Locafy launched Localizer in the U.S. market, generating over A$156,000 in new monthly subscriptions within two months, equating to approximately A$1.9 million in annualized recurring revenue [7][12]. - The introduction of Localizer SAB, aimed at enhancing Google Business Profile rankings for Service Area Businesses, has already seen early adoption among home-services contractors [8][12]. Operational Highlights - A strategic partnership was executed in June 2025 with a leading U.S. reputation and review-management platform, expanding Locafy's addressable market in North America [9]. - The company streamlined its core product offering to focus on local SEO and AI Engine Optimization solutions, enhancing automation and scalability for local businesses [4][12]. - Monthly recurring revenue (MRR) for the fiscal fourth quarter was A$267,000, reflecting a 4.2% increase from the comparable year-ago period [19].

Locafy's Sales Increase with Rapid Adoption of Localizer Product in Insurance Sector
Globenewswire· 2025-09-25 11:15
Core Insights - Locafy Limited has launched a new AI-driven marketing platform through LoHi Digital, targeting U.S. insurance brokers, leveraging its advanced technology suite [1][2][3] Company Overview - Locafy is a global software-as-a-service technology company specializing in location-based digital marketing solutions, including AI-powered search engine optimization [1][12] - The company's flagship product, Localizer, is designed to help businesses achieve top visibility in local search results, particularly in competitive sectors like insurance, home services, and healthcare [2][4] Product Adoption and Revenue - Within the first week of adoption, 50 State Farm agencies have adopted the Localizer platform, with total participation reaching 74 agencies, generating over US$51,000 in monthly recurring revenue (MRR) [3][10] - The company anticipates that every 120 Localizer sales will add approximately US$1 million in annual recurring revenue (ARR) [6] Market Opportunity - The U.S. insurance market presents significant opportunities, with over 880,000 licensed insurance agents and brokers, including more than 19,000 State Farm agents [7] - Locafy aims to penetrate various local services industries, including healthcare and home improvement, which have millions of small businesses reliant on local visibility [7] Strategic Partnerships and Growth - Locafy has signed new partner agreements with leading agencies in the U.S. and Australia, generating initial sales for the Localizer product [8] - The company has launched an AI sales team in the U.S. targeting the roofing and home services markets, indicating a strategic expansion of its service offerings [8]
Locafy Reports Fiscal Nine-Month 2025 Results and Highlights Operational Progress, Positioning the Company to Scale
Globenewswire· 2025-08-29 20:05
Core Insights - Locafy Limited has expanded its U.S. presence through strategic partnerships and enterprise wins, focusing on AI-powered product innovations to drive market adoption [1][3] - The company has established a partner-led go-to-market model that is expected to accelerate growth [1][5] Strategic Partnerships & Market Expansion - Signed multi-year, high-value partnerships in the U.S. and APAC with significant deployment potential [6] - Entered a strategic agreement with a U.S.-based online reputation platform, expanding Locafy's U.S. listings footprint by approximately 10,000 end users [7] - Launched an AI-powered SEO product suite, including Localizer, aimed at multi-location businesses [6][7] - Secured large agency and enterprise clients, representing thousands of potential locations for imminent revenue generation [6] Product Innovations - Localizer is gaining traction with large agencies and high-volume partners, positioned as a key growth driver [4] - The AI-driven SEO product suite aims to enhance local and national search visibility with minimal human intervention [7][14] - Developed an integrated Article Accelerator for in-house article creation and publishing, compliant with Google's SEO policies [14] Financial Performance - Total operating revenue for the nine-month period ended March 31, 2025, was AUD $2.4 million, down from AUD $2.9 million in the same period of 2024 [12][14] - Subscription revenue was AUD $2.2 million, compared to AUD $2.6 million in the prior year [14] - Net loss totaled AUD $3.5 million, or AUD $2.19 per share, compared to a net loss of AUD $2.1 million, or AUD $1.63 per share, in the previous year [15] Key Performance Indicators - Monthly recurring revenue (MRR) for the fiscal third quarter was AUD $261,000, reflecting a 1% sequential increase but a 2% year-over-year decrease [16]
